Excerpt:
But Capel, who is still only 41 years old, has ultimately decided to be extremely patient with his career -- the way Shaka Smart was at VCU, the way Brad Stevens was at Butler, the way Archie Miller is right now at Dayton -- and wait for an absolutely perfect opportunity before committing to becoming a head coach again, mostly because he's currently in a great spot as the associate head coach for, and right-hand man to, Hall of Famer Mike Krzyzewski. Beyond all that, Capel will be an obvious candidate to take over at Duke whenever Krzyzewski eventually retires. So although Capel is anxious to again run his own program, it will, at this point, take something really special to get him to leave his alma mater, sources told CBS Sports.
If true about the "really special" criteria, I don't think Jeff's leaving for any of the openings right now.
